答:为提高转炉挡渣效果,国内外在挡渣技术方面进行了深入研究,自1970年日本发展挡渣球出钢挡渣方法以来,各国为完善挡渣技术,发明了十几种挡渣方法。从挡渣技术的发展趋势来看,国外正在逐步从有形挡渣法向无形挡渣法方向发展。由于用挡渣球等有形挡渣物挡渣,材料消耗高,挡渣效果不理想。国外不少钢厂已采用了无形挡渣法,并配
